Foreign Policy Goals for 2000

Secretary of State Madeleine Albright talked about the goal of democratic advancement throughout the world in 2000. She focused on the U.S. agenda to strengthen NATO, deal with threats regarding weapons of mass destruction, and promote peace in Northern Ireland and the Middle East. After her remarks she answered questions from the audience. close
